GT86 Mount, Nexus 7 (2013), and Torque App...

I was looking for a solution for my compulsive need to know everything about my car in realtime. I have been spoiled by the Gran Tourismo inspired display in my GT-R. I felt like there had to be an option for the BRZ and thus I started searching the internet for anything that would fit the bill. Finally I found the TORQUE App and read great reviews from thousands of happy TORQUE users. Unfortunately for me this App is only for android devices of which I had none. After not being able to find anything I finally gave in and bought a Nexus 7 32GB (2013) model from amazon. After receiving my Nexus 7 and an ELM 327 BT OBDII reader and getting it set up; I was pleased with the outcome - less the oh shit moment of... how do I mount this thing. After research I found that some people replaced their OEM head units with the Nexus 7 but unlike many BRZ owners I happen to like the OEM NAV unit. So for me that wasn't an option. After several hours of searching google I found GT86mounts http://www.gt86mounts.com/product.wm...-SHIPPING-.htm. I have installed my Nexus 7 with this mounting system with awesome results. I use my Nexus 7 for everything including YouTube, DISH Network Slingbox, Internet access, Torque App, and much more. I am very happy with this setup!
